Player Prop Bets and Team Performance Insights
In today's discussion, Morez Johnson is highlighted for his exemplary performance in the tournament, remaining impactful with his 100% shooting rate and eyeing 8 rebounds. His dominance, even against Howard, has not gone unnoticed, as he continues to command respect with his efficient plays.
Turning our attention to Joe Joe Tugler, who is identified as the "true X factor" for his team, he's projected to exceed his rebound prop of 7 or 7.5 (depending on the sportsbook). Ranked 35th in offensive rebounding percentage, Tugler faces a team that allows a significant amount of offensive rebounds, positioning him well to capitalize on second-chance opportunities, especially if he stays out of foul trouble.
The conversation also covers Texas A&M's potential in their upcoming game, with a specific focus on Darius Acuff who is tapped to have a standout performance based on previous matchups against weaker defenses like High Point. His ability to perform against teams outside of the top 100 defenses in the SEC, such as Oklahoma, Auburn, and LSU, supports predictions of him delivering notable scoring outputs.
Moving to team dynamics, Arkansas's rigorous schedule in the SEC tournament is contrasted with High Point's more relaxed schedule, which might lead to a stamina advantage for the latter. However, confidence remains high that Arkansas will be geared up and ready, with expectations set for them to exceed the team total early in the game, exploiting High Point's defensive vulnerabilities.
Lastly, the discussion touches upon the Duke vs. TCU game, spotlighting the defensive prowess of both teams. Predictions lean towards a low-scoring game, expecting under 139.5 points as both teams are recognized for their defensive efficiency and ability to control the pace of the game.
